Output ccfcbdcc216694bd29df435e1501e0f14aea55b01cc3c5d40c104cbdfb923002:1

value
17536894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a54a4dbe3b90faabea6493ad541fe2a0f885b646 OP_EQUAL
address
3GkzRuWrgLkSib1rtBSaSjr2nDCd1hAjEH
transaction
ccfcbdcc216694bd29df435e1501e0f14aea55b01cc3c5d40c104cbdfb923002
confirmations
233928
spent
true